Major architectural changes and improvements: ## ADK Framework Migration (v0.10.0) - Migrated from LangChain/LangGraph to Google ADK 1.3.0 with LiteLLM 1.80.5 - Improved tool calling reliability with local Ollama models - Converted all 10 tools to ADK async generator format - Updated streaming pipeline for ADK event system - Enhanced error handling and agent initialization ## Model Optimization - Switched from gemma3:12b (10GB VRAM) to gemma3:4b (4.8GB VRAM) - Reduced VRAM usage from 91% to 43% (5.4GB freed) - Optimized for production stability with memory headroom ## Health Check System Overhaul - Optimized /health/full: 6ms response (was 30s+) - Added model verification: confirms configured model is available - New /health/diagnostics endpoint with optional deep testing - Added currently loaded models tracking - Clear emoji status indicators (✅/❌/⚠️) - Fixed AGENT_AVAILABLE flag export for proper health reporting ## Ollama Client Enhancements - Added list_models() method for model inventory - Enhanced model verification in health checks - Better error handling and reporting ## Documentation Updates - Updated STATUS.md to v0.10.0-adk-migration - Comprehensive CHANGELOG.md entry with migration details - Updated PLANS.md showing Phase 4 complete - Updated ai-orchestrator-plan.md with ADK status - Added MIGRATION_PLAN_LANGCHAIN_TO_ADK.md - Added ADK_Ollama_Research.md with implementation analysis ## Technical Details - 10 tools: 7 infrastructure + 2 research + 1 response tool - Framework: Google ADK with UnifiedAgent pattern - System prompt: v7_adk_best_practice - Container health: Now passing Docker healthchecks - Response times: Simple queries ~0.3-1s, Research ~4-7s

Framework Migration Completed (2025-11-26) ✅:
- ✅ Migrated from LangChain/LangGraph to Google ADK 1.3.0
- ✅ Integrated LiteLLM 1.80.5 for Ollama compatibility
- ✅ Converted all 9 tools to ADK async generator format
- ✅ Upgraded model: mistral:7b → gemma3:12b
- ✅ Optimized system prompt: v7_adk_best_practice
- ✅ Enhanced agent health monitoring
- ✅ Production testing and validation
Migration Benefits Achieved:
- Improved tool calling reliability with Ollama models
- Better streaming support with ADK event system
- Model flexibility (Gemma, Mistral, Qwen families supported)
- Cleaner, more maintainable architecture
- Production-ready health monitoring
Current Implementation:
- Framework: Google ADK 1.3.0 with LiteLLM
- Model: gemma3:12b (~8GB VRAM)
- Tools: 9 total (7 infrastructure + 2 research)
- Performance: Simple queries ~0.3-1s, Research ~4-7s
